Mastering Roblox Commands: The Ultimate 2025 Guide to Power, Control, and Customization
May 27, 2025
Read: What Does AFK Mean in Roblox?
Read: What is Roblox GG? Everything You Need to Know
Read: How to Make a Shirt in Roblox: A Comprehensive Guide to Designing, Testing, and Uploading
Roblox, one of the largest online platforms for user-generated games, offers boundless creativity and immersive gameplay. Whether you are a game developer, server admin, or a player aiming to enhance your Roblox experience, mastering Roblox commands can be a game-changer.
Roblox commands are powerful tools that allow you to control your game environment, manage players, customize gameplay, and troubleshoot issues—all with simple text inputs. In this comprehensive guide, you’ll learn everything about Roblox commands—from basic usage and popular commands to advanced scripting and security practices—so you can take full command of your Roblox universe.
Table of Contents
What Are Roblox Commands?
How Do Roblox Commands Work?
Getting Started: Permissions and Admin Systems
Basic Roblox Commands You Should Know
Advanced Commands and Customizations
Creating and Scripting Custom Commands
Admin Scripts Overview: Kohau, Adonis, HD Admin, and More
Security Best Practices When Using Commands
Troubleshooting Common Command Issues
Real-World Use Cases and Tips for Admins and Developers
Top 20 Frequently Asked Questions (FAQs) About Roblox Commands
Conclusion: Take Control and Master Roblox Commands
1. What Are Roblox Commands?
Roblox commands are textual instructions entered into a game’s chat or developer console that trigger specific actions or behaviors in the game. These commands enable fast and efficient control over gameplay elements without needing complex coding or game restarts.
They can be as simple as kicking a disruptive player or as complex as spawning objects, teleporting players, adjusting game rules, or changing the environment dynamically.
Two Main Contexts for Roblox Commands
In-Game Admin Commands: These are commands accessible to players with administrative permissions inside a Roblox game. They typically require an admin script installed by the game creator.
Developer Console Commands: Used by developers inside Roblox Studio or live games to debug or test scripts, such as changing player properties, teleporting, or simulating events.
2. How Do Roblox Commands Work?
Roblox commands usually require:
An admin script: This is a Lua script included in the game that listens for specific chat inputs and executes corresponding functions.
Admin permissions: The script controls who can use commands, often based on player user IDs or roles.
Command syntax: Commands typically start with special characters like
!
or/
followed by a command keyword and optional arguments (like player names or numbers).
Example command in an admin-enabled game:
This command, when entered by an admin, removes “PlayerName” from the server immediately.
3. Getting Started: Permissions and Admin Systems
How to Gain Admin Access
Only designated admins can use powerful commands. Admin access can be granted in several ways:
By the game creator: The developer can assign themselves or trusted friends admin status.
Admin lists: Many admin scripts allow you to create a list of user IDs or usernames that have admin privileges.
Rank systems: Advanced admin scripts include rank hierarchies with varying levels of command access.
Popular Admin Scripts
Some widely-used admin scripts in Roblox include:
Adonis Admin: Popular for its extensive command list and user-friendly interface.
Kohau Admin: Known for simplicity and reliability.
HD Admin: Features a powerful command system and easy permissions.
Basic Admin: Lightweight and straightforward, great for small servers.
Installing these scripts usually involves adding them to your game in Roblox Studio and configuring user permissions.
4. Basic Roblox Commands You Should Know
Once you have admin access, certain commands become essential tools for managing your game.
Player Management Commands
!kick [PlayerName]
— Kicks a player from the server. Useful for removing disruptive players.!ban [PlayerName]
— Bans a player from rejoining the server.!unban [PlayerName]
— Removes a ban on a player.!mute [PlayerName]
— Prevents a player from chatting.!unmute [PlayerName]
— Allows a muted player to chat again.!freeze [PlayerName]
— Stops a player from moving.!unfreeze [PlayerName]
— Allows a frozen player to move.
Gameplay and Environment Commands
!tp [Player1] [Player2]
— Teleports Player1 to Player2’s location.!give [PlayerName] [ItemName]
— Gives a player an item.!kill [PlayerName]
— Kills a player’s character instantly.!respawn [PlayerName]
— Respawns a player’s character.!time [value]
— Sets the game time (e.g., day or night).!weather [type]
— Changes the weather if supported.
Server Control Commands
!shutdown
— Shuts down the server (use with caution).!restart
— Restarts the server or game.!announce [message]
— Broadcasts a message to all players.
5. Advanced Commands and Customizations
Command Aliases
Many admin systems allow you to create aliases — shortcuts or alternative command names to speed up your workflow. For example, !k
could be an alias for !kick
.
Command Groups and Permissions
Advanced scripts support role-based command access, meaning you can assign groups (moderator, admin, superadmin) with different levels of command access. This adds security and hierarchy.
Cooldowns and Spam Prevention
To prevent command abuse, you can set cooldown timers so that a command can only be used once every few seconds or minutes.
6. Creating and Scripting Custom Commands
Mastering Roblox commands goes beyond using pre-built commands — you can script your own! Roblox uses Lua for scripting, and admin scripts usually have modules where you can define new commands.
Basic Steps for Custom Commands
Identify the admin script’s command handler: Most scripts have a table or module where commands are registered.
Write your command function: Define what happens when the command is called.
Register your command: Add your function to the command list with a keyword and optional aliases.
Set permissions: Specify which ranks or users can execute it.
Example: Creating a Simple "!dance" Command
This example would make a player’s avatar perform a dance animation when they type !dance
.
7. Admin Scripts Overview: Kohau, Adonis, HD Admin, and More
Adonis Admin
Extensive command list
User-friendly GUI
Built-in logging and moderation tools
Custom command support
Kohau Admin
Lightweight and easy to set up
Simple command syntax
Good for smaller servers
HD Admin
Advanced permission system
Supports custom commands and aliases
Integrated chat and GUI controls
Basic Admin
Minimalist design
Essential commands only
Suitable for beginner developers
Each script has pros and cons; choosing depends on your game’s scale and requirements.
8. Security Best Practices When Using Commands
Limit Admin Access
Only trusted players should have admin privileges. Keep your admin list private and update it regularly.
Use Whitelisting
Restrict command access using whitelists or rank permissions.
Command Logging
Enable logging to record command usage, making it easier to investigate abuse or mistakes.
Regular Updates
Keep your admin scripts and Roblox Studio updated to patch vulnerabilities.
9. Troubleshooting Common Command Issues
Commands Not Working: Verify that the admin script is installed and enabled, and that you have the correct permissions.
Player Not Found: Ensure you are typing exact player names; usernames are case sensitive.
Syntax Errors: Check for missing spaces, typos, or incorrect prefixes.
Lag or Server Crash After Commands: Avoid mass teleporting or spawning; optimize commands and server performance.
10. Real-World Use Cases and Tips for Admins and Developers
Moderation: Use commands like
!kick
,!ban
, and!mute
to maintain a friendly community.Game Events: Teleport players for events or change game settings dynamically using commands.
Debugging: Use commands to test scripts, spawn NPCs, or simulate player actions.
Customization: Create custom commands to give players unique powers or game modes.
11. Top 20 Frequently Asked Questions (FAQs) About Roblox Commands
1. How do I get admin commands in Roblox?
Admin commands are usually granted by the game creator through an admin script. You must be added to the admin list to use commands.
2. What is the difference between commands and scripts?
Commands are inputs that trigger actions, whereas scripts are Lua code that runs inside the game to create mechanics, including command handling.
3. Can regular players use commands?
Usually no; commands are restricted to admins or specific ranks to prevent abuse.
4. What is the most popular admin script?
Adonis Admin is highly popular due to its features and ease of use.
5. Can I create my own commands?
Yes, with scripting knowledge, you can add custom commands to your admin script.
6. Are commands case sensitive?
Most commands and player names are case sensitive, so type carefully.
7. Can commands cause lag?
Yes, especially commands that spawn many items or teleport multiple players simultaneously.
8. How do I ban a player permanently?
Use the !ban PlayerName
command and ensure your admin script saves bans between sessions.
9. Can commands be used on mobile Roblox?
Yes, but you must use the chat interface, and some commands may be limited by UI.
10. How do I troubleshoot commands not working?
Check permissions, ensure the script is active, and verify syntax.
11. Is it possible to restrict commands by time or usage?
Yes, advanced admin scripts support cooldowns and timed restrictions.
12. How can I mute a player who is spamming?
Use !mute PlayerName
to prevent chat messages.
13. Can commands be used to spawn items?
Yes, if the admin script supports it and items exist in the game’s inventory.
14. Are commands safe for all players?
Commands require careful permission management to prevent misuse.
15. Can I see who used commands on my server?
Yes, through command logs if your admin script supports logging.
16. What if a player abuses commands?
Revoke their admin status immediately and investigate via logs.
17. Do commands work in all Roblox games?
No, only in games with admin scripts installed.
18. How do I update my admin script?
Replace the old script with the latest version in Roblox Studio and publish updates.
19. Can commands be used to teleport between different games?
No, teleportation commands only work within the same game server.
20. Are commands useful for new developers?
Absolutely! They help with testing and managing your game during development.
Take Control and Master Roblox Commands
Roblox commands are a powerful way to control gameplay, moderate communities, and develop dynamic games. Whether you’re a new developer or an experienced admin, understanding how commands work and how to use them effectively will dramatically improve your Roblox experience.
Start by gaining admin access, learning essential commands, and experimenting with custom scripts. Always prioritize security and responsible use to maintain a fun and fair environment for all players.
With the knowledge from this guide, you’re now equipped to master Roblox commands and unlock limitless possibilities in your Roblox worlds!
Read: Beginner's Roblox Guide for Kids: How to Get Started with the Ultimate Game Creation Platform
Read: How to Enhance Your Roblox Skills: A Beginner’s Guide to Mastering Roblox Game Development
Read: Essential Skills Kids Learn from Roblox: A Fun and Educational Gaming Platform
Read: 10 Tips to Become a Roblox Expert This Summer
Read: What to Do in 2025 If Your Kids Love Minecraft or Roblox: Ultimate Guide for Parents

More blogs